Ellen is making smoothies. The recipe calls for 1 and 1/4 cups of strawberries. How many cups of strawberries, written as a fraction greater than one, are used in the recipe?
Answer:
the number of cups of strawberries needed in the recipe is ⁵/₄
Step-by-step explanation:
Given;
cups of strawberries needed for the smoothies = 1 and 1/4 cups
To obtain the number of cups of strawberries needed in the recipe as a single fraction, the given mixed fractions will be converted into an improper fraction.
Note: Improper fractions are always greater than 1
Number of cups of strawberries [tex]=1 + \frac{1}{4} = \frac{4 + 1}{4} = \frac{5}{4}[/tex]
Therefore, the number of cups of strawberries needed in the recipe is ⁵/₄

In ΔABC, ∠C is a right angle. Find the remaining sides and angles. Round your answers to the nearest tenth.
b= 20, c=40
Answer:
The remaining side and angles are [tex]a = 20\sqrt{3}[/tex], [tex]\angle A = 60^{\circ}[/tex] and [tex]\angle B = 30^{\circ}[/tex].
Step-by-step explanation:
According to the information given on statement, we are in front of a right triangle because [tex]\angle C[/tex], opossite to side [tex]c[/tex], is a right angle. Hence, [tex]c[/tex] is the hypotenuse of the right triangle and [tex]b[/tex], a leg. The missing length can be calculated by the Pythagorean Theorem:
[tex]a = \sqrt{c^{2}-b^{2}}[/tex] (1)
If we know that [tex]c = 40[/tex] and [tex]b = 20[/tex], then the length of the missing leg is:
[tex]a = \sqrt{c^{2}-b^{2}}[/tex]
[tex]a = 20\sqrt{3}[/tex]
Lastly, we find the value of the missing angles by means of direct and inverse trigonometric relations:
Angle A
[tex]\angle A = \tan^{-1}\left(\frac{a}{b} \right)[/tex] (2)
Angle B
[tex]\angle B = \tan^{-1} \left(\frac{b}{a} \right)[/tex] (3)
If we know that [tex]a = 20\sqrt{3}[/tex] and [tex]b = 20[/tex], then the values of the missing angles are, respectively:
Angle A
[tex]\angle A = \tan^{-1}\left(\frac{a}{b} \right)[/tex]
[tex]\angle A = 60^{\circ}[/tex]
Angle B
[tex]\angle B = \tan^{-1} \left(\frac{b}{a} \right)[/tex]
[tex]\angle B = 30^{\circ}[/tex]
The remaining side and angles are [tex]a = 20\sqrt{3}[/tex], [tex]\angle A = 60^{\circ}[/tex] and [tex]\angle B = 30^{\circ}[/tex].

if food has 5g fat, 10g protein and 20g carbs, how many calories is it (9,4,4)?
Answer:
165 Calories
Step-by-step explanation:
A gram of carbohydrate contains 4 calories. A gram of protein also contains 4 calories. A gram of fat, though, contains 9 calories
5x9=45 10x4=40 20x4=80 45+40+80= 165
